g93 | “I’m honored to be his teammate.” —Joe Saunders, re: Raul

Mariners 8 | Angels 3

When you hear sincere respect like that coming out of a clubhouse, it bears repeating.
I know that it’s more important for the young guys to do well because they are the future (and there was a good share of that in this game as well) but, it is pretty cool to watch this incredible, unexpected season that Raul is having. And, you KNOW it’s got to be helping these youngsters – in EVERY way imaginable. Raul has always been a great role model as a person and a player with an exceptional work ethic and a willingness to share his knowledge and experience (because players like Jamie Moyer and Edgar did it for him) but, for him to be having a season like this at age 41 is pretty special. You go, Raul!

AT THE PLATE
~ Once again, Kyle extends TWO streaks with ONE swing . . .
his personal hitting streak to TWELVE and the M’s consecutive game homers to TWENTY (club record)
~ Rauuuuuul hit not one but TWO more homers (#23 went into the Hit It Here Cafe, #24 to right center)
~ Kendrys went back-to-back with Raul in the 7th
~ Mike’s been comin’ ’round, THREE more hits (including a double) and an RBI tonight
